Liverpool midfielder James Milner sent a gushing message to Reds youngster Rhian Brewster after his dazzling display against Tranmere Rovers on Thursday.

The 19-year-old made an emphatic return from injury in the team’s first pre season friendly of the off season, scoring twice as Jurgen Klopp’s side beat their Merseyside neighbours 6-0 at Prenton Park.

Milner was thrilled for the young man, while he included a cheeky Divock Origi-themed hashtag, as well: “Good run out tonight,” he wrote on his personal Twitter account.

“Delighted to see Rhian back & doing what he does best! #anyonefancyabrew #shockdivscored #preseason.”

OPINION

It certainly was good to see Brewster back in action on Thursday, and it’s a sight that will have delighted not just Liverpool supporters, but English football fans in general. There was such excitement surrounding Brewster when he first burst onto the scene with England’s youth teams, but the major injury that kept him out of essentially the entirety of last season really slowed his progress. However, he is clearly someone who Klopp has high hopes for, and Milner is obviously a fan as well. Him saying that Brewster scoring twice is him being back to what he does best tells you all you need to know about what the veteran midfielder thinks of the youngster as a goalscorer. Milner has emerged as an unexpectedly comedic figure in recent years, and his use of the #shockdivscored hashtag is further evidence of that, referencing the Belgian international coming on and scoring once again for the Reds on Thursday.
